The Issaquah Food and Clothing Bank (IFCB) is developing the Harvest Issaquah program, in which we coordinate "Picking Parties" comprised of volunteers aged sixteen and older at local farms and with community members who currently have gardens and would like to donate a portion of their crop to the IFCB for distribution to our clients.
Picking Parties will take place on Thursday afternoons and during Saturday "brunch hours" from June to October and will involve meeting up at the IFCB before carpooling to Picking Party locations, harvesting produce selected for donation, transporting it back to the IFCB, weighing it in, and washing and crating it for future distribution to our clients, as well as other organizations we partner with.
The IFCB also needs approximately 50 Gleaners (2-3 per team), who are able to quickly and efficiently harvest quality berries, vegetables and fruit on Thursday afternoons and/or Saturday "brunch hours", under the direction of the Lead Volunteers. Having the ability to drive/carpool, transport donations, and assist with sorting, washing and crating the produce will be helpful as well.
The time commitment may vary from 2-3 hours once or twice a week, depending upon your availability, as well as the availability of produce for harvest. The harvest season will last from June to October.
As Gleaner, you would not be required to participate in every Picking Party! We understand that everyone has busy lives and can only volunteer within their own availability; but your commitment and presence will benefit the IFCB's clients, the community members who have excess produce in need of harvesting, as well as your team.

Mission Statement
The mission of the Issaquah Food and Clothing Bank is to provide basic needs to our community members to promote self-sufficiency.
Description
We envision a hunger-free community.
Values:
Respect - We believe in respect and equity.
Support - We believe in nurturing and supporting clients and each other.
Acceptance - We believe in being non-judgmental and accepting our differences.
Partnership - We believe that through collaboration and partnership we can accomplish so much more.
We provide basic needs, such as food, clothing and toiletries to the community. We have several special programs, including Caring through Sharing Holiday Gifts, Tools 4 Schools Backpack Program and Summer Lunches.
